The Chicago Coalition for the Homeless is an advocacy organization. Our success comes from the collaborative effort of many people.
You can help by:
1. Taking action with us through letter writing, calling your legislator or attending a rally. The way to find out about these opportunities is to sign up for our email action alerts.
2. Educating fellow members of your congregation, university or civic group by inviting our Speakers Bureau to come out and share their story of homelessness and experience fighting for change with CCH.
3. Forming a core team at your congregation, university, or civic group if one doesn’t already exist to advocate for the end and prevention of homelessness. Read about students at North Eastern Illinois University who are getting their fellow students involved.
4. Volunteering at a local shelter. Look for opportunities at http://www.volunteermatch.org/
